Abstract
In experiments with albino mongrel female rats a study was made of the absorption of 249Bk from the gastrointestinal tract after a single per os administration. The bulk of 249Bk (96 per cent) administered either intravenously or per os was mainly deposited in the skeleton and liver. The value of 249Bk absorption from the gastrointestinal tract by days 4 and 8 following administration was 0.05 per cent.
